Here's what I've bought:
3.42 posi rear
3" Flowmaster catback
3" cat
1 5/8" w/3" y pipe MAC headers
L31 Vortec heads
LT1 cam
Now I need to finish it up, heres what Im thinking:
Edelbrock Performer RPM intake
Holley 4bbl -> tbi adaptor
GM 2200 stall
Does it seem like a good setup, or should I change some stuff? Suspension stuff will come in about a month once I get some more money.
Thanks!

that set up shoudl be fine. my only suggestion woudl be a little bit looser torque convertor. something in the 2800 range will be better for the LT1 cam.

I guess my last question is, would you get the heads milled .045 down to keep compression up, or just leave them how they are so they can be easily thrown on a 350?

i woudl mill them, even if you throw them on a 350 you can just get stock style flat tops with valve reliefs and still be pump gas friendly.
